Philadelphia: Jewish Publication Society. Very Good in Very Good dust jacket; Owner name on front free endpaper, . jacket rubbed.. 1972. Hardcover. 0829502300 . Volume II of the twelve-volume set by Zinberg, translated from the Yiddish by Bernard Martin. Decorated tan cloth binding. xv, 257pp, index. Bibliographical notes, glossary of Hebrew and other terms, index. ; 8vo 8" - 9" tall .

Old Saratoga Books owners Dan and Rachel Jagareski have been selling books since 1996. After running an open shop for twenty years in the historic village of Schuylerville we now sell books online and at book fairs. We are members of the Independent Online Booksellers Association (IOBA). Our specialties include books about history, science, cooking, children's books, and the arts. Rachel is a graduate of the Colorado Antiquarian Book Seminar and has attended Rare Book School in Charlottesville, Virginia.
